How to Memorize Scripture as a Family
Lead your family into the heart of God. Memorize Scripture together! Here are some tips on how to do it effectively.
1. Establish a routine. Set a specific time every day to memorize Scripture together. Whether it's first thing in the morning, during a meal, or before bedtime. Whatever time works best, start with it and stick with it. Be consistent. The more you do it, the less you'll have to think about it. It will just happen naturally.
2. Create a Bible memory group for your family. Get your family involved in selecting passages or verse topics to memorize together. You will be able to track each other's progress and even compete for the top spot on the leaderboard!
3. Reward. Award a prize to the first one to reach your family's memorization goal, or reward the entire family when everyone reaches your goal. Rewards can be simple or grandiose. Get creative, and have fun!
You may be amazed at how quickly your family can memorize extended passages, like the Sermon on the Mount or The 10 Commandments. Just take a verse or two at a time. Your family will carry it with them for life, and you will leave an inheritance that can't be taken away.
"And these words that I command you today shall be on your heart. You shall teach them diligently to your children, and shall talk of them when you sit in your house, and when you walk by the way, and when you lie down, and when you rise." Deuteronomy 6:6-7 ESV
